Beschreibung
Zusammenfassung:The effects of acid deposition on dystrophic peat are analyzed with a series of laboratory experiments. In the tests, water having a variety of concentrations of calcium, magnesium, and hydrogen ions is equilibrated with peat samples. Atmospheric calcium and hydrogen-ion inputs profoundly affect the equilibrium pH of surface levels of dystrophic peat. Attempts to quantify the effects of hydrogen-ion load on the pH of peat are described. These results can then be used to determine the acid load that would cause a measurable shift in the pH of the surface peat.
